Heads up: the password reset revamp on Quillbase keeps flaking in CI because the mail-stub container starts slower than the test runner expects. If you see timeouts in reset_flow_spec, just retry once before panicking — Priya's fix lands next sprint. Don't bump the timeout globally; it hides real bugs. To confirm you're on the patched pipeline, check the token below.

pipeline stamp: htk9_ce63042d9

### Versioning policy

The Hollyvale component library follows semver, with one twist: visual-only changes count as minor, token renames count as major. Consumers pin to a minor range and upgrade via the codemod pack. Release cadence, deprecation windows, and support horizons are encoded as constants so tooling and docs can't drift apart. The values future maintainers should keep in sync are listed here.

constants for bagaf-hadup:
QUOTAS = {
    "quenael": 1,
    "ralwyn": 1,
    "oliath": 2,
    "ulaael": 2,
}

## Changelog — Fabricant v3.0.0 (test-data factory)

### Changed defaults

This release changes several long-standing defaults in the Fabricant factory library. Generated records are now deterministic by default (seeded per test run), associations are built lazily rather than eagerly, and timestamps default to a fixed epoch instead of wall-clock time. Teams relying on the old randomized behavior must opt back in explicitly. Upgraded suites will run with the following configuration values:

service settings:
[briius]
port = 3000
region = outer-1
host = briius.zarqeldyn.internal
team = wenael
timeout_ms = 2000
retries = 5

= HSM Delivery: What Receiving Needs to Know =

The new hardware security module for the Quillstone vault arrives this week from Bramber Systems. It ships in a tamper-evident crate — don't open it, that's the crypto team's job. Just check the crate for dents, photograph all six sides, and park it in the caged area. Two people must be present at acceptance. The courier handover follows the confidential line below.

courier memo of yahif-faweg: the quenael tamius courier leaves the prawyn jorix kaswyn istox silmir brieth zormir fenvan ledger at gate 3145 under passcode 231062